You and your family can usually get AHCCCS if your family’s income is at or below 138% of the Federal Poverty Guidelines (FPG) ($20,120 for an individual in 2023, $41,400 for a family of four). Glenn St.AHCCCS reserves the right to request off-cycle revalidations. During the revalidation process the provider is subject to the same screening and disclosures captured during the initial enrollment. Please include:Q: Can I schedule recurring automatic payments from my credit card or bank account to pay my premium? A: Yes, you can schedule an automatic payment that will process on the due date which is the 15th of each month – if the 15th of the month is a holiday or weekend, it will be the next business day after the 15th of the month.
